Lagos Inaugurates MOC For Senatorial Games

pmnews-placeholder

Lagos State government has inaugurated the Main Organising Committee (MOC) for the Senatorial Games that will commence soon in the state.

Commissioner for Youth, Sports and Social Development, Prince Ademola Adeniji-Adele, while inaugurating the committee said that the MOC should come up with a detailed action plan that would enable members of the State Executive Council (EXCO) to adopt and promote the the tournament in their various senatorial districts.

Prince Adeniji-Adele also opined that the Senatorial Games is essentially a grassroots’ sports for catching and developing young talents that abound in the state.

The chairman of the inaugurated MOC, Deji Wellington, who is also a board member of Lagos State Sports Council, on behalf of himself and other members, thanked the state governor, Babatunde Raji Fashola and the Commissioner for giving them the opportunity to serve.

Wellington said the MOC will strive to meet the government’s expectations and also surpass these expectations. He also promised that the MOC will not abuse the confidence reposed in the committee.

Other members of the MOC include Mr. S. Alasela; Mrs. Babs, the Director of Sports, Lagos State Sports Council, Mr. Bolaji Yusuf, Mr. Ogidan, Mr. Bamidele Disu and Surveyor Olayemi.
